Specification
| Temperature(°C/°F) | Resistance(kohms) |
|---|---|
| 10/14 | 45.9 |
| 0/32 | 25 |
| 20/68 | 8.43 |
| 40/104 | 3.27 |
| 60/140 | 1.4 |
| 80/176 | 0.7 |
* RESISTANCE VALUE OF ENGINE COOLANT TEMPERATURE SENSOR AS A FUNCTION OF TEMPERATURE
Scheme 73
Scheme 74
- Connect scantool with diagnostic connector.
- Warm up the engine to normal engine temperature after engine starts.
- Select and monitor "Water temperature sensor" parameter.
- Is the Water temperature sensor normal? YES Go to " «INSPECTION AND REPAIR»(ref-537307-S26940526132013032200000) " procedure. NO This is a intermittent problem caused by poor contact of component or Control Unit. Thoroughly check the looseness, poor connection, bent, corrosion, contamination, deformation or damage of connector. Repair or replace as necessary and then, go to " «VERIFICATION OF VEHICLE REPAIR»(ref-537307-S14752129552013032200000) " procedure.

| Door position | Voltage |
|---|---|
| FRE | 0.3±0.15V |
| REC | 4.65±0.15V |
* VOLTAGE VALUE OF INTAKE POTENTIOMETER AS A FUNCTION OF POSITION OF INTAKE DOOR
Scheme 77
Scheme 78
- Check Actuation Test Connect scantool with diagnostic connector. Warm up the engine to normal temperature after engine start. Select "Intake Potentiometer" parameter on the current data with scantool. Perform Actuation Test for Air Inlet Mode Selection - Recirculation/Fresh in order. With performing Actuation test, check that the value of each position sensors are changing. Specification: Recirculation: About 90%, Fresh: About 10%. Are the value of each position sensors changed when performing actuation test? YES This is a intermittent problem caused by poor contact of component or Control Unit. Thoroughly check the looseness, poor connection, bent, corrosion, contamination, deformation or damage of connector. Repair or replace as necessary and then, go to " «VERIFICATION OF VEHICLE REPAIR»(ref-537307-S12804401842013032200000) " procedure. NO Go to " «INSPECTION/REPAIR»(ref-537307-S29351149872013032200000) " procedure.

| Temperature(°C/°F) | Resistance(kohms) |
|---|---|
| 20/-4 | 285.6 |
| 10/14 | 164 |
| 0/32 | 97.7 |
| 10/50 | 59.67 |
| 20/68 | 37.4 |
| 30/86 | 24.1 |
| 40/104 | 15.9 |
| 50/122 | 10.8 |
* RESISTANCE VALUE OF INCAR TEMP SENSOR AS A FUNCTION OF TEMPERATURE
Scheme 81
Scheme 82
- Connect scantool with diagnostic connector.
- Warm up the engine to normal engine temperature after engine starts.
- Select and monitor "In-car temperature sensor 1" parameter.
- Is the Incar temperature sensor normal? YES This is a intermittent problem caused by poor contact of component or A/C Control Unit. Thoroughly check the looseness, poor connection, bent, corrosion, contamination, deformation or damage of connector. Repair or replace as necessary and then, go to " «VERIFICATION OF VEHICLE REPAIR»(ref-537307-S24472923562013032200000) " procedure. NO Substitute with a known good In-Car Temp. Sensor and check for proper operation. If the problem is corrected, replace In-Car Temp. Sensor and then go to " «VERIFICATION OF VEHICLE REPAIR»(ref-537307-S24472923562013032200000) " procedure.

| Temperature(°C/°F) | Resistance(kohms) |
|---|---|
| 20/-4 | 271.4 |
| 0/32 | 95.1 |
| 25/77 | 30 |
| 50/122 | 11 |
| 60/140 | 7.58 |
* RESISTANCE VALUE OF AMBIENT TEMP.SENSOR AS A FUNCTION OF TEMPERATURE
Scheme 85
Scheme 86
- Connect scantool with diagnostic connector.
- Warm up the engine to normal engine temperature after engine starts.
- Select and monitor "Ambient Air Temperature sensor" parameter.
- Is the ambient sensor abnormal? YES Go to " «INSPECTION AND REPAIR»(ref-537307-S08346837902013032200000) " procedure. NO This is a intermittent problem caused by poor contact of component or Control Unit. Thoroughly check the looseness, poor connection, bent, corrosion, contamination, deformation or damage of connector. Repair or replace as necessary and then, go to " «VERIFICATION OF VEHICLE REPAIR»(ref-537307-S27126343642013032200000) " procedure.

| Temperature(°C/°F) | Resistance(kohms) |
|---|---|
| 20/-4 | 43.3 |
| 0/32 | 27.6 |
| 10/50 | 18 |
| 20/68 | 12.1 |
| 30/86 | 8.3 |
| 40/104 | 5.8 |
* RESISTANCE VALUE OF EVAPORATOR SENSOR AS A FUNCTION OF TEMPERATURE
Scheme 89
Scheme 90
- Connect scantool with diagnostic connector.
- Warm up the engine to normal engine temperature after engine starts.
- Select and monitor "Evaporator sensor" parameter on scantool.
- Is the Evaporator Sensor abnormal? YES Go to " «INSPECTION AND REPAIR»(ref-537307-S13932959212013032200000) " procedure. NO This is a intermittent problem caused by poor contact of component or Control Unit. Thoroughly check the looseness, poor connection, bent, corrosion, contamination, deformation or damage of connector. Repair or replace as necessary and then, go to " «VERIFICATION OF VEHICLE REPAIR»(ref-537307-S18275012012013032200000) " procedure.
| Door position | Voltage |
|---|---|
| Max. cool | 0.3±0.15V |
| Max. warm | 4.7±0.15V |
* VOLTAGE VALUE OF AIR MIX POTENTIOMETER AS A FUNCTION OF TEMP DOOR POSITION
Scheme 91
Scheme 92
- Actuation Test Connect scantool with diagnostic connector. Warm up the engine to normal engine temperature after engine starts. Select and monitor "Air Mix Door Potentioner-Driver" parameter on scantool. Select and perform Actuation test Air Mix Door Potentioner-Driver - 0% / 50% / 100% in order. With performing Actuation test, check that the value of Air Mix Door Potentiometer follows is changed and close to the value of Actuation Test. Specification: Check that the value of Air Mix Door Potentiometer at current data should be close to the value of the actuation test. Does the value of current data follow in accordance with the each actuation test? YES This is a intermittent problem caused by poor contact of component or Control Unit. Thoroughly check the looseness, poor connection, bent, corrosion, contamination, deformation or damage of connector. Repair or replace as necessary and then, go to " «VERIFICATION OF VEHICLE REPAIR»(ref-537307-S40068368332013032200000) " procedure. NO Go to " «INSPECTION/REPAIR»(ref-537307-S25790680972013032200000) " procedure.

| Mode Door Position | Voltage |
|---|---|
| VENT | 0.3±0.15V |
| BI-LEVEL | 1.4±0.4V |
| FLOOR | 2.5±0.4V |
| MIX | 3.6±0.4V |
| DEF | 4.7±0.15V |
* VOLTAGE VALUE OF POTENTIOMETER AS A FUNCTION OF MODE DOOR POSITION
Scheme 95
Scheme 96
- Actuation Test Connect scantool with diagnostic connector. Warm up the engine to normal engine temperature after engine starts. Select and monitor "Direction Potentiometer" parameter on scantool. Select and perform Actuation test Driver Mode Door - Face / Foot / Defrost in order. Check that the value of all the parameters are changed when performing the actuation test. Specification: Face - About below 10%, Foot: About 50%, Defrost: About 90%. Are all the parameters changed when performing Actuation test? YES This is a intermittent problem caused by poor contact of component or Control Unit. Thoroughly check the looseness, poor connection, bent, corrosion, contamination, deformation or damage of connector. Repair or replace as necessary and then, go to " «VERIFICATION OF VEHICLE REPAIR»(ref-537307-S19982995492013032200000) " procedure. NO Go to " «INSPECTION/REPAIR»(ref-537307-S03894291452013032200000) " procedure.
